[Traditionally we] go out after football, we sit together and things would be discussed then, we don’t have paper, we don’t write these kind of things, and that is the effectiveness. The [Iwokrama-instituted] CEWs supposed to be prepared every time, at all time, to sit, chat to people: every time an opportunity is created, to discuss, to tell somebody about something. But you see what we’ve done … what we’ve done with the CEW programme, we have made it formal, we have made it more a Western system. So that is what you get: You’ve asked for this, and the people give you … they give you 12 hours’ support and that’s it.
